Legislature Passes Cap and Trade Extension 
On Monday, July 17, the Legislature voted to pass AB 398 (E. Garcia) which extends California’s Cap and Trade program through 2030. Governor Brown’s primary legislative objective for the year was to extend this program. Through hard fought negotiations, the Governor persuaded the Legislature to pass the program extension with a two-thirds supermajority vote of the Legislature.
Senate Fast Tracks Energy and Natural Resources Act of 2017
The U.S. Senate is fast-tracking last year’s failed effort to authorize the EPA WaterSense program to certify water-efficient home products and services. CASA supports the creation of a WaterSense program but urges Congress to ensure that any technology promoted or certified does not degrade water quality.

Clean Water State Revolving Fund: We’re Urging More Funding and Improvements 
This fund for water quality infrastructure projects may be slashed in the FY 2018 federal budget. We’ve urged congressional delegation members to not only restore the funding but to increase it. At the state level, we’re also participating in workshops to help streamline the process. 
CASA Represents Wastewater Stakeholders Before Expert Panel
The Science Advisory Panel for Constituents of Emerging Concern reconvened to update their recommendations for recycled water monitoring. We addressed the panel on July 19 in Orange County to provide input on the updates.

Pat Sinicropi to Join WateReuse Association in September
The WateReuse Association has appointed Pat Sinicropi to serve as its new Executive Director. Many CASA members know Pat well from her prior roles with the National Association of Clean Water Agencies and the Water Environment Federation.
She succeeds Melissa Meeker who now heads the Water Research and Recycling Foundation.
Grant Davis Appointed as Director of the Department of Water Resources
Governor Brown has appointed Grant Davis, Sonoma County Water Agency General Manager, as Director of the California Department of Water Resources (DWR) effective August 1st, 2017. Davis has been with the Sonoma County Water Agency since 2007 and has served as General Manager since 2010. Davis will replace acting DWR Director William R. Croyle.
Monterey Agency Name Change Reflects Sign of Times 
If you haven’t heard, the Monterey Regional Water Pollution Control Agency is now Monterey One Water. “The agency is beginning a new era of total water management and updating the name reinforces the commitment of the Board of Directors to participating in cooperative regional water solutions,” says General Manager Paul Sciuto.
CASA Members Picked for WIFIA Loans
The EPA just announced its pick of 12 projects to apply for Water Infrastructure Finance and Innovation Act (WIFIA) loans. CASA members San Francisco Public Utilities Commission and the City of San Diego were among those chosen.
